85. Do not Pass Me By

1 Do not pass me by, dear Saviour,
Tho’ I may unworthy be;
Tho’ my heart be stained and sinful,
Look with mercy, Lord, on me.

Refrain:
Even me, O gentle Saviour,
Pardon, heal and comfort me,
Even me, O gentle Saviour,
Let Thy mercy fall on me.

2 Do not pass me by, dear Saviour,
I am hopeless but for Thee;
Let me hide beneath Thy pinions;
Look with favor, Lord, on me. [Refrain]

3 Do not pass me by, dear Saviour,
Make my blinded eyes to see;
Speak the word that shall restore me;
Let Thy goodness rest on me. [Refrain]

Text Information
First Line: Do not pass me by, dear Saviour
Title: Do not Pass Me By
Author: Rev. W. C. Martin
Refrain First Line: Even me, O gentle Saviour
Language: English
Publication Date: 1902
Notes: Public Domain.
Tune Information
Name: [Do not pass me by, dear Saviour]
Composer: J. M. Black
Notes: Public Domain.
